Página 1 de 1
Como clicar em um arquivo e saber o nome dele
Enviado: 23 Jul 2020 15:48
por porter
Olá pessoal, com esse comando, consigo abrir todos os arquivos com extensão .txt na pasta c:\arquivostxt, como faço
para ao clicar em determinado arquivo pegar o nome dele para imprimi-lo com o WIN32PRN, ou outro comando onde
eu consiga selecionar o arquivo, pegar o nome dele para imprimir, quero atribuir o nome para variavel arq .
Código: Selecionar todos
arq := MemoRead( win_GetOpenFileName(, "", "c:\arquivostxt\", "TXT", "*.TXT", 1 ) )
W32PRN(arq,"HP DESKJET 3510",cTipoImpCupom)
Harbour 3.2(dev)
Obrigado.
Como clicar em um arquivo e saber o nome dele
Enviado: 23 Jul 2020 18:41
por Claudio Soto
En HMG tenes:
https://www.hmgforum.com/viewtopic.php? ... Easy+build
No es para imprimir, es para compilar proyectos con un click, pero se podria adaptarlo
Como clicar em um arquivo e saber o nome dele
Enviado: 23 Jul 2020 18:50
por JoséQuintas
porter escreveu:como faço
para ao clicar em determinado arquivo pegar o nome dele para imprimi-lo com o WIN32PRN
o cara pega o nome
win_GetOpenFileName(, "", "c:\arquivostxt\", "TXT", "*.TXT", 1 )
já pegando o conteúdo
arq = memoread( ... )
e usa o conteúdo como se fosse nome
W32PRN(arq,"HP DESKJET 3510",cTipoImpCupom)
e pergunta como pegar o nome.....
Se quer o nome, porque pegou o conteúdo?
Tem dia que de noite é fod.... kkkkk
Como clicar em um arquivo e saber o nome dele
Enviado: 23 Jul 2020 19:21
por porter
Boa noite JoseQuintas, eu achei que com essa rotina eu conseguiria pegar o nome do arquivo selecionado, para usar posteriormente,
mas ele me traz o conteúdo, qual comando devo usar para pegar o nome de tal arquivo selecionado, obrigado por sua atenção.
Como clicar em um arquivo e saber o nome dele
Enviado: 23 Jul 2020 19:37
por porter
Agora deu certo, dessa forma consigo pegar o nome, obrigado Cláudio Soto e JoséQuintas.
Código: Selecionar todos
arq := ( win_GetOpenFileName(, "", "c:\arquivostxt\", "TXT", "*.TXT", 1 ) )
Como clicar em um arquivo e saber o nome dele
Enviado: 23 Jul 2020 20:14
por JoséQuintas
porter escreveu:Agora deu certo, dessa forma consigo pegar o nom
Pois é, você já tinha feito, mas imendou com o MemoRead() que já usa o nome pra ler o arquivo.